The 3,500-sqm Omniverse Museum is every dork’s walk-through dreamland. Since it opened last March 8, 2023, the Omniverse Museum featured 20 different rooms, showcasing Star Wars, Marvel and DC Superheroes, Harry Potter and other fictitious TV and movie worlds. Krems is a twin city: Stein, the place where the toll was collected and Krems, the market town. It was a trading hub. Currently, it has 26,000 permanent inhabitants. It boasts of 3 private universities and an additional 10,000-12,000 students who take their further studies in Krems. Krems also features the second biggest commercial port […]
